 What is a lead tracking system?

A lead tracking system is a software program that helps businesses track and manage customer leads. It typically includes features such as customer contact information, lead source, lead status, and lead notes. Lead tracking systems help businesses stay organized and informed about the progress of their leads, allowing them to focus on closing deals.

What are the features of a lead management system?

1. Contact information: Collect and store contact information of leads, such as name, email, phone, and address. 

2. Lead source: Track the source of each lead, such as a website, advertisement, or referral. 

3. Lead status: Monitor the progress of each lead, such as open, closed, or pending. 

4. Lead notes: Record notes about each lead, such as customer feedback or sales conversations.

 5. Sales automation: Automate tasks such as scheduling follow-up emails or calls. 

6. Lead scoring: Assign points to leads based on criteria such as customer engagement or lead source. 

7. Reporting: Generate reports to gain insights into lead performance.

How Lead Automation System Works? Watch Video

A lead automation system is a tool that helps businesses to automate and streamline the lead management process. It typically includes features such as lead capture, lead qualification, lead nurturing, and lead conversion, which help businesses to efficiently and effectively manage and track potential customers throughout the sales process.

Here's a brief overview of how a lead automation system typically works:

1. Lead capture: The lead automation system captures potential customer information, such as name, contact information, and interests, through forms on a website or other marketing channels.

2. Lead qualification: The system then uses predetermined criteria to qualify leads and determine which are most likely to convert into paying customers. This may involve identifying the lead's needs, budget, and decision-making authority.

3. Lead nurturing: The system then provides qualified leads with relevant content and communication to continue to educate and build trust with the business. The goal is to keep the lead engaged and interested until they are ready to make a purchase.

4. Lead conversion: When a lead is ready to make a purchase, the lead automation system helps to facilitate the conversion process, including completing a purchase or signing up for a trial or demo.

Throughout the process, the lead automation system tracks and analyzes the progress of each lead, including the communication and interactions with the lead, to understand what is most effective in converting leads into customers. This data can then be used to optimize the lead management process and improve the overall sales strategy.

Benefits of Lead Management Software

Lead management is the process of identifying, qualifying, and nurturing leads to turn them into paying customers. A lead is a person or company that has shown an interest in a product or service, and lead management involves tracking and organizing the progress of leads through the sales funnel.

There are several benefits to implementing a lead management system, including:

1. Improved efficiency: A lead management system allows businesses to track and organize leads in one place, making it easier to manage and follow up on them.

2. Increased productivity: By automating certain tasks and providing a clear process for following up on leads, a lead management system can free up time and resources that can be better spent on other important tasks.

3. Better customer experiences: A lead management system allows businesses to track and respond to customer inquiries and needs in a timely and organized manner, improving the overall customer experience.

4. Increased revenue: By effectively managing and converting leads, businesses can increase their revenue by turning more leads into paying customers.

5. Improved data insights: A lead management system allows businesses to track and analyze data on leads, such as their location, demographics, and interests, which can help inform marketing and sales strategies.
